Pretty easy and fast if you have a lathe. The crown isn't very much, like 2 degrees so set the compound to
2 degrees may have to come up with a simple mandrel to chuck it up. Its called taper turning by the compound rest method......do one side flip pulley around and where the two tapers meet in the middle just soften that
with file or some emery cloth.......

I've done just that with pulleys for belt sanders. If you want to get fancy you can set the compound to one degree after doing the two degree taper and knock off the corner to make a two-step taper. Works well.

I've been reading "Echoes from the Oil Field" written by a machinist in Pennsylvania oil county in the early 1900's - it was a column in American Machinist and has been reprinted as collections.
He has one column where he talks about the "new improved" radius crowned pulleys that appear, he had been using pulleys with a simple taper on each side. The radius was said to increase belt life and transmit more power. Osborn's final response after trying the "new improved" pulleys is to chuck one up on a lathe and cut the radius into a simple double taper so the belt will stay on. He said he had not had problems with belt life with the taper crowned pulleys.
My little experience with flat belt power all had the radius crown type pulley, or flat for the small motor pulleys. Never had a too much problem with them till you wanted some serious power, then they would crawl off a pulley sometimes.

One should also consider the belt; any non uniformity as might be expected in a hide, or other worn belting material, would make the belt stretch more on one side when loaded, thus encouraging it to move off center.

I made a crowned 3"-diameter pulley for my belt sander. Nothing to it. The crown doesn't have to be a perfectly rounded radius. When you're down around a degree, two straight cuts that meet in the middle of a pulley look almost exactly like a round crown. You can file down the middle or sand it if it makes you feel better.

I took a shortcut many people won't agree with. I crowned one side of the pulley, turned it around in the chuck, and crowned the other side. With such a light cut and shallow crown, it didn't matter that the chuck was gripping a taper. I was even able to bore it while holding it this way, but if I had had a choice, I would have done the boring and everything else BEFORE the crown.

Interesting thing: while I was researching crowned pulleys, I learned that you only need one of them in a three-pulley belt sander. The others can be flat.

If you look around, you can find a page that gives recommended crown heights for flat belts. It's very, very little. My crown was cut with the compound at 0.5 degrees.

You can make a crown with a file very quickly, and it's less aggravation. You can rest a straightedge on the pulley to see where the crown is, and if it's off, just move it.
